Knies scores 2 goals and Maple Leafs snap 3-game skid with 4-2 win at Bruins




BOSTON (AP) — Matthew Knies scored a pair of goals and the Toronto Maple Leafs snapped a three-game losing streak with a 4-2 victory over the Boston Bruins on Tuesday night.
